        riscv64: drop MAXPHYSMEM_128GB

        The MAXPHYSMEM config options have been removed upstream via the
        following commit, so we drop our setting.

           commit 6250ecf5ba42292b652cd01c9fcb2239010c5c44
           Author: Alexandre Ghiti <alexandre.ghiti@canonical.com>
           Date:   Mon Jan 17 10:57:16 2022 +0100

               riscv: Get rid of MAXPHYSMEM configs

               commit db1503d355a79d1d4255a9996f20e72848b74a56 upstream.

               CONFIG_MAXPHYSMEM_* are actually never used, even the nommu defconfigs
               selecting the MAXPHYSMEM_2GB had no effects on PAGE_OFFSET since it was
               preempted by !MMU case right before.

               In addition, the move of the kernel mapping at the end of the address
               space broke the use of MAXPHYSMEM_2G with MMU since it defines PAGE_OFFSET
               at the same address as the kernel mapping.

4790588211 classes: add setuptools3_legacy
Following a good discussion with PyPA upstream[1] the migration of the
setuptools3.bbclass to use bdist_wheel+pip turns out to be more complex
than thought.

Essentially, we're midway through a lot of changes: the future of Python
packaging is wheels and pip, but those by design are not as flexible as
traditional distutils and setup.py.

Specifically, with traditional distutils the package can implement its
own install task and write arbitrary files (such as init scripts).  With
wheels this is explicity impossible, so packages that do this cannot use
the new setuptools class and must continue to use the build/install tasks
as before.

This class is the old setuptools behaviour, bought back. However, as
distutils and the setuptools install task are both deprecated and will
soon be removed entirely, any users of this class should be moving to an
alternative build tool, be it a modern Python tool which works with
wheels, or a non-Pythonic tool such as Meson.

967ff0e2af binutils: Avoid Race condition in as.info
The race condition in binutils/gas folder was introduced with the
following patch. The patch avoids recursive make into the doc folder.
It would speed up the build process slightly. However, the as.info
is installed twice which resulted in the race condition sometimes.
https://sourceware.org/git/?p=binutils-gdb.git;a=commit;h=bde299e063de090bf36c1fe51874d1e9f4d94c3c

On debugging the code, it was found that the issue was related to
install-data-local. On further analysis, there is already a patch in
binutils that removes install-data-local.
On applying the patch as.info is installed once as expected and there’s
no possibility of any race condition.
